'Wonderful World' EP 5 gets 9.9% rating nationwide, surpasses 'Flex X Cop'

Episode 5 of “Wonderful World” starring Kim Nam-joo and Cha Eun-woo rose sharply in the ratings and surpassed Ahn Bo-hyun and Park Ji-hyun’s “Flex X Cop.” 

“Wonderful World” is a Korean human mystery drama about a professor who exacts revenge when her son is killed.

Based on data from Nielsen Korea, episode 5 of “Wonderful World” on March 15 on channel MBC got a  nationwide rating of 9.9 percent in South Korea, its highest to date, rising to second place among terrestrial shows behind the Monday-Friday drama “Unpredictable Family,” which posted 11.7 percent. It was watched by 1.61 million people. 

The episode 5 rating for “Wonderful World” is 3.5 percentage points higher than the 6.4 percent nationwide rating the drama got for episode 4 on March 9.  

It surpassed “Flex X Cop,” which garnered 8.3 percent (fourth place) for episode 13 on March 15, down from 10.1 percent it received for episode 12 on March 9. 

Meanwhile, “Wonderful World” bagged first place and posted a double-digit rating for the first time in South Korea’s metropolitan area (Seoul, Gyeonggi and Incheon).   

“Wonderful World” got a rating of 10.2 percent in the metropolitan area, up by 4 percentage points from 6.2 percent for episode 4 on March 9. It was watched by 1.11 million people. 

It surpassed “Unpredictable Family,” which slid to second place with 9.7 percent in the metropolitan area. “Flex X Cop” placed fourth with 8.1 percent. 

Today, March 16, Cha Eun-woo will hold his "2024 Just One 10 Minute [Mystery Elevator]" in Manila at the SM Mall of Asia Arena, presented by Pulp Live World. 

“Wonderful World” is available on Disney+ outside South Korea including the Philippines.
